4-hole bath taps – elegant installation on the bath rim
A 4-hole bath mixer is a solution designed for baths with a wide rim or for exclusive freestanding baths that have appropriately prepared mounting holes. It is characterised by the separation of functions into four independent elements, mounted directly on the surface of the bath. This system ensures exceptional elegance, minimising the visibility of the installation itself and creating a cohesive, sophisticated look that blends perfectly with the lines of the bath.
Design and Functionality – what does the 4-hole system consist of?
The 4-hole system is the most complete and convenient type of bath tap, combining the functions of filling and showering in a single, integrated panel on the bath. It consists of four key elements:
- First Outlet: An elegant spout used to fill the bath with water.
- Second and Third Outlets: Separate controls (knobs or levers) for regulating hot and cold water, or a single lever for mixing water and a spray selector.
- Fourth Outlet: A pull-out shower head which, when not in use, tucks away discreetly into the edge of the bath, maintaining a clean and minimalist look.
When should you choose a 4-hole tap?
Choosing a bath-mounted (4-hole) tap is justified in specific cases where an exclusive look and comfort are desired:
- Bathtubs with Wide Rims: Ideal for installation on the wide, flat edges of rectangular or asymmetrical bathtubs, which provide sufficient space for all four components.
- Luxury Freestanding Baths: Some freestanding models are designed for this type of installation, offering an alternative to a freestanding floor-mounted tap.
- Design: If you are aiming for a minimalist look on the walls and want the taps to be a natural part of the bath, a 4-hole system is the optimal choice.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
Does a 4-hole tap fit any bath?
No. A 4-hole tap requires a bath with a sufficiently wide rim that is factory-prepared (pre-drilled) for four holes or allows them to be drilled safely. You should always check the bath’s specifications to ensure it is compatible with this type of tap installation.
Is the pull-out shower head in a 4-hole system practical?
It is very practical and convenient. It allows you to easily rinse the bath after a bath, quickly wash your hair without having to get up completely, and because it retracts back into the bath rim after use, it does not take up space on the wall and maintains a minimalist look.
Is a 4-hole tap more difficult to install than a standard wall-mounted one?
Installing a 4-hole tap requires greater precision in positioning the plumbing and careful routing of the hoses and trap under the bath. Although installing the bath itself with integrated fittings may be quicker than with a concealed tap, the whole process requires space under the bath for four components and the shower hose.
